r rSafeguarding Your Home: Beyond Just Technology
rWhile advanced technology is significant, a well-designed security system hinges on a few critical factors:
r r Solid doors and jambs with good locks: Ensure that your entry points are secure and less vulnerable.r Unobstructed views for windows: Avoid shrubbery or other objects that could obscure your windows, making break-ins easier.r Good lighting: Proper illumination around your home deters potential intruders.r Alarm systems over cameras: For the best security, opt for an alarm system that can notify you and the authorities immediately. A camera is valuable, but it serves mainly as evidence after an incident has occurred. Video monitoring requires constant vigilance, which may not always be feasible.r rA monitored alarm system can notify you and the authorities immediately. If you self-monitor, ensure that you are alert and responsive to alerts in all situations. Otherwise, you may miss critical notifications. Additionally, having non-911 dispatch numbers for local police, fire, and ambulance services is essential to ensure immediate assistance.
r rEnhancing Your Security with Dogs, Guns, and High-Quality Cameras
rDogs serve as an excellent deterrent to potential intruders. However, they can be overcome by a drugged steak or worse. Guns are a powerful tool, but only effective if you can quickly access and use them. Good lighting is also crucial. A combination of reliable high-quality cameras, door and window alarms, and effective lighting increases your security significantly.
